Article: Ford holds the line on enviro initiatives.(News)

Byline: Jim Johnson

America's automotive industry is in the midst of an unprecedented upheaval amid the worst economic meltdown since the Great Depression.

But that's not having an impact on environmental initiatives at Ford Motor Co., the only one of the Big 3 automakers to avoid bankruptcy protection and a government bailout.

"We have not altered our plans due to the downturn, Ford spokeswoman Jennifer Moore said.
